Role Overview
Conduct research to understand how humans and AI can work together most effectively. You will study user behavior in human-AI collaborative environments, identify optimal balance points between automation and human control, and ensure AI systems enhance rather than diminish human capabilities.

Key Responsibilities
- Conduct user research on optimal human-AI collaboration patterns across 19 industries
- Study emotional and psychological impact of AI integration on human workers and customers
- Research cultural differences in human-AI interaction preferences across global markets
- Analyze user behavior to identify when humans prefer manual control vs AI automation
- Study long-term effects of AI adoption on human skill development and job satisfaction
- Research trust-building mechanisms between humans and AI systems
- Conduct accessibility research ensuring AI systems work for users with diverse abilities
- Study ethical implications of AI integration on human autonomy and decision-making
- Research optimal training methods for humans working alongside AI systems
- Analyze customer satisfaction patterns in human-AI collaborative service environments
